Output 78566424339ae0224632b45de06807c63695d67026a28ffd668bf7b2bd871da1:3

value
147000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c0ce2a04a834c36d92816df4a5e6e144205f69 OP_EQUAL
address
3CWvdXdF2NxwXvLpR6cEfrsmfY6UE7U8fd
transaction
78566424339ae0224632b45de06807c63695d67026a28ffd668bf7b2bd871da1
spent
true